Frequently Asked Questions about Hickman

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in Hickman, CA?

As of today, August 02, 2026, there are currently 102 available Hickman apartments priced from $570 to $2,865, with an average monthly rent of $1,517.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hickman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hickman ranges from $1,200 to $2,045 with an average monthly rent of $1,602.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hickman c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hickman range from $740 to $2,437.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,806.

How expensive are Hickman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 24 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hickman on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,061 to $2,865 - averaging $1,923 for the location.
